Notes:
Cover title. "This biting political poetry satire combines Goswell's techniques of rubberstamping text cut from erasers with her paste-up (collaged) techniques. Goswell states "Thanks Marvin Sackner for your encouragement" in the colophon page ... 1 hard cover book + pages (eraser stamped, collaged, paper, ink, handwriting, photocopied fragments) (33 pages) in cover (cloth covered, museum boards, collaged, paper, photocopied, ink colored, handwriting)) ; 32.5 x 20.4 x 1.1 cm ... Published: Valencia, Pennsylvania : [Publisher not identified]. Nationality of creator: American."--Sackner catalog. Copy 1 Sackner CC# 33630-35287 IaU
Summary:
A sarcastic alphabet book on American history.
